| Run ID | 作者 | 问题 | 语言 | 测评结果 | 分数 | 时间 | 内存 | 代码长度 | 提交时间 |
|---|---|---|---|---|---|---|---|---|---|
| 14936 | 罗炜翰 | 排队打水问题 | C++ | 通过 | 100 | 1 MS | 260 KB | 337 | 2025-11-29 09:23:25 |
#include<bits/stdc++.h> using namespace std; int main() { int n,r,sum=0; cin>>n>>r; int t[n],s[r]; for(int i=0;i<n;i++){ cin>>t[i]; } sort(t,t+n); int l=0; for(int i=0;i<r;i++){ s[l]=t[i]; l++; } for(int i=r-1;i<n;i++){ s[i-r]+=s[i-r]+t[i]; } for(int i=0;i<r;i++){ sum+=s[i]; } cout<<sum; }